This month we bring you a few new twists to our favorite standby. But before we get to the recipes, we’d like to share some tips on making great mashed potatoes every time.

First, start with great potatoes! You can use any type of potato for mashed potatoes, but potatoes differ in the amount of starch they have and therefore will differ in consistency and texture when mashed. We prefer organic russet potatoes, which are high in starch and produce a fluffy, light mashed potato.

To thin potatoes into the perfect velvety texture, we use half & half instead of milk or cream. Half & half will add just the right balance between creamy and too thin.

When adding butter, half & half or other ingredients, make sure they are at room temperature, or warm, this will keep your potatoes from cooling off.

And finally, whatever flavorings you add, be sure to salt and pepper to taste as your final step.
